Professor, Biotechnology

The Department of Chemical/Biotech/Environmental Engineering in the School of Engineering Technology and Aviation is looking for outstanding individuals to join our dedicated faculty team.

Under the direction of the Associate Dean, Professors in this department are responsible for providing academic leadership for developing an effective learning environment.​

RESPONSIBILITIES:

The duties of this position will include, but are not limited to the following:

​Deliver developed theoretical (lecture) and practical (lab) material.
​Create a positive learning environment in the classroom and laboratories.
​Deliver theory and practical application at both the College Diploma and Degree level.
​Create a positive learning environment in the classroom and other learning spaces.
​Use a variety of teaching and learning strategies including classroom lectures and workshops, online learning, video recordings, simulations and experiential learning.
​Use a variety of techniques to evaluate student achievement of learning outcomes.
​Demonstration of student-centered course design and delivery, including aspects of Universal Design for Learning and intercultural competence.
​Assess student feedback and industry trends to develop, deliver and revise curriculum.
​Engage in applied research.


QUALIFICATIONS:

The successful applicant must have:

​A PhD in Biology, Bioengineering or equivalent.
​Experience in biotechnology, general, analytical and physical chemistry, physics, unit operations, QA/QC.
​Experience with creating and managing research initiatives.
​Prior teaching experience at the post-secondary level would be an asset.
​Competence with an on-line learning environment including experience hosting virtual class-rooms e.g. Zoom or Teams.
​Experience with on-line Learning Management systems.
​Ability to work both independently and as part of a team in a flexible and cooperative manner.
​Excellent organizational and problem-solving skills.
​Demonstrated commitment and understanding of human rights, equity, diversity and inclusion with the ability to communicate and work effectively inter-culturally with diverse groups of students, employees and the community.
